Fish meal-free diet supplemented with health promoters support optimal growth in gilthead sea bream (Sparus aurata), with beneficial changes in gene expression, intestinal microbiota and intestinal disease recovery

Here, we tested a novel aquafeed formulation containing a gut health modulator, aquaculture by-products, black soldier meal and microbial biomass generated by fermentation of Corynebacterium glutamicum and Methylococcus capsulatus as the main protein sources in a FM-free diet. The effects on growth performance; targeted liver, head kidney and intestinal gene expression; intestinal microbiota composition; and parasite disease outcome were assessed to evaluate the potential use of this novel and sustainable feed formulation in aquaculture. At the gut level, main attention was focused on the posterior intestine due to its relevance as the main target tissue for the economically important intestinal parasite Enteromyxum leei, used for the challenging of fish in an infective model of cohabitation.
